From 256439b7669374971c941c4c1b12ac755b9a587a Mon Sep 17 00:00:00 2001 From: Hendrik Hofstadt Date: Wed, 19 Aug 2020 15:14:39 +0200 Subject: [PATCH] Fix solana agent --- solana/Cargo.lock | 23 +++++------------------ solana/agent/src/main.rs | 2 +- 2 files changed, 6 insertions(+), 19 deletions(-) diff --git a/solana/Cargo.lock b/solana/Cargo.lock index 46c5c00a..f873a579 100644 --- a/solana/Cargo.lock +++ b/solana/Cargo.lock @@ -2277,7 +2277,7 @@ dependencies = [ [[package]] name = "solana-crate-features" version = "1.4.0" -source = "git+https://github.com/solana-labs/solana#46830124f8b98c72ff58e6e1c723fb1cbdb75e4e" +source = "git+https://github.com/solana-labs/solana?branch=master#e2d66cf796484301668c2b45804e31610373a0e9" dependencies = [ "backtrace", "bytes 0.4.12", @@ -2334,7 +2334,7 @@ dependencies = [ [[package]] name = "solana-logger" version = "1.4.0" -source = "git+https://github.com/solana-labs/solana#46830124f8b98c72ff58e6e1c723fb1cbdb75e4e" +source = "git+https://github.com/solana-labs/solana?branch=master#e2d66cf796484301668c2b45804e31610373a0e9" dependencies = [ "env_logger", "lazy_static", @@ -2401,7 +2401,7 @@ dependencies = [ [[package]] name = "solana-sdk" version = "1.4.0" -source = "git+https://github.com/solana-labs/solana#46830124f8b98c72ff58e6e1c723fb1cbdb75e4e" +source = "git+https://github.com/solana-labs/solana?branch=master#e2d66cf796484301668c2b45804e31610373a0e9" dependencies = [ "assert_matches", "bincode", @@ -2439,7 +2439,7 @@ dependencies = [ [[package]] name = "solana-sdk-macro" version = "1.4.0" -source = "git+https://github.com/solana-labs/solana#46830124f8b98c72ff58e6e1c723fb1cbdb75e4e" +source = "git+https://github.com/solana-labs/solana?branch=master#e2d66cf796484301668c2b45804e31610373a0e9" dependencies = [ "bs58", "proc-macro2 1.0.19", @@ -2464,7 +2464,7 @@ dependencies = [ [[package]] name = "solana-sdk-macro-frozen-abi" version = "1.4.0" -source = "git+https://github.com/solana-labs/solana#46830124f8b98c72ff58e6e1c723fb1cbdb75e4e" +source = "git+https://github.com/solana-labs/solana?branch=master#e2d66cf796484301668c2b45804e31610373a0e9" dependencies = [ "lazy_static", "proc-macro2 1.0.19", @@ -2579,19 +2579,6 @@ dependencies = [ "thiserror", ] -[[package]] -name = "spl-token" -version = "1.0.8" -dependencies = [ - "cbindgen", - "num-derive 0.3.1", - "num-traits", - "rand", - "remove_dir_all", - "solana-sdk", - "thiserror", -] - [[package]] name = "spl-token" version = "1.0.8" diff --git a/solana/agent/src/main.rs b/solana/agent/src/main.rs index 3c8dcbd8..d3f3bbac 100644 --- a/solana/agent/src/main.rs +++ b/solana/agent/src/main.rs @@ -53,7 +53,7 @@ impl Agent for AgentImpl { let b = self.key.to_bytes(); let key = Keypair::from_bytes(&b).unwrap(); - let ix = match post_vaa(&self.bridge, &key.pubkey(), &request.get_ref().vaa) { + let ix = match post_vaa(&self.bridge, &key.pubkey(), request.get_ref().vaa.clone()) { Ok(v) => v, Err(e) => { return Err(Status::new(